Abstract
- The functioning of a smart city relies upon six key factors, which are smart governance, environment, living, people and mobility. This paper focuses on the smart mobility factor, within the context of a smart university which is a surrogate of a smart city. A proof of concept transport system will be developed. The transport system will consist of a third-generation bicycle-sharing platform, which will explore the usage of several technology paradigms such as the Internet of Things (IoT) and blockchain technology. The transportation system will consist of a permissioned Proof Of Authority (POA) blockchain network of docking stations, which users of the smart university campus will interact with through a mobile application to rent and dock bicycles.
